📊 Income Tax Rates 2025

France uses a progressive tax system (impôt sur le revenu) administered by Direction générale des Finances publiques:

  • €0 - €11,294 0%
  • €11,295 - €28,797 11%
  • €28,798 - €82,341 30%
  • €82,342 - €177,106 41%
  • €177,107+ 45%

Rates apply to single taxpayers (quotient familial affects married couples)

🏛️ Social Charges (Charges Sociales)

French social security contributions fund healthcare, unemployment, and retirement:

  • Employee Contributions ~17.2%
  • Employer Contributions ~42-45%
  • CSG (income) 9.2%
  • CRDS 0.5%

Contributions cover Sécurité Sociale (health), unemployment insurance, and pension schemes.

🛒 TVA (Value Added Tax)

France's consumption tax system with multiple rates:

  • Standard Rate 20%
  • Reduced Rate 10%
  • Super Reduced Rate 5.5%
  • Special Rate 2.1%

TVA registration required for businesses exceeding €85,800 (goods) or €34,400 (services) annual turnover.

🏠 Common Deductions

Popular tax deductions for French taxpayers:

  • Professional expenses 10% forfait or actual
  • Childcare costs Up to €3,500/child
  • Domestic help 50% tax credit
  • Charitable donations 66% tax reduction

France offers various tax credits (crédit d'impôt) and reductions for qualifying expenses.

🏡 Wealth Tax (IFI)

Real estate wealth tax for high-value property owners:

  • Threshold €1,300,000
  • Rate 0.5% - 1.5%
  • Scope Real estate only

Impôt sur la Fortune Immobilière (IFI) replaced ISF in 2018, applying only to real estate assets.
